Why mold odors persist:
Mold produces microbial volatile organic compounds (MVOCs) as it grows and digests organic materials. These compounds create the distinctive musty smell associated with mold. Two primary compounds responsible for this odor are geosmin and 2-methylisoborneol.
According to the Environmental Protection Agency, your nose detects these compounds at incredibly low concentrations, often before visible mold appears. This sensitivity means a persistent musty smell despite cleaning indicates ongoing mold growth, even when you cannot see contamination.
Cleaning versus remediation:
Surface cleaning removes dirt, debris, and some odors. However, cleaning cannot eliminate musty smell from mold growing inside walls, under flooring, in insulation, or other hidden locations where most basement mold thrives.
If you have thoroughly cleaned your Burlington basement, including walls, floors, and stored items, yet musty smell returns within days or weeks, hidden mold growth almost certainly exists, requiring professional investigation.
Temporary versus permanent odors:
Temporary basement odors from recent dampness, stored items, or inadequate ventilation typically dissipate with cleaning, airing out, and moisture control. These odors do not persist despite remediation efforts.
Musty smell that stubbornly remains regardless of cleaning intensity indicates biological growth producing odor compounds faster than cleaning can eliminate them. This persistence demands professional assessment.

Humidity’s effect on mold activity:
Mold growth accelerates when relative humidity exceeds 60%. Burlington basements often reach 70-80% humidity during the summer months, especially near Lake Geneva. This elevated humidity activates mold growth, increasing metabolic activity and MVOC production.
When the musty smell becomes noticeably stronger during humid days or rainstorms, it indicates living mold responding to environmental conditions. This biological response pattern confirms actual contamination rather than simple dampness.
Seasonal odor patterns:
Many Burlington homeowners notice a musty smell worsening during the humid summer months and then improving slightly during the drier winter periods. This seasonal variation strongly suggests mold growth cycling with moisture availability.
However, winter improvement does not mean mold has disappeared. Instead, growth temporarily slows during low-humidity periods. Mold remains present, ready to resume active growth when humidity increases again.
Rain-related odor increases:
Musty smell intensifying within hours or days after rain indicates water intrusion supporting mold growth. Foundation leaks, window well drainage problems, or sump pump issues allow water entry during rain events. This moisture feeds mold, creating immediate odor increases.
If you notice musty smell correlated with rainfall, a professional inspection should identify water entry points, while mold remediation addresses existing contamination.
Dehumidifier impact on odors:
Running dehumidifiers that reduce basement humidity below 50% should noticeably decrease musty smell from active mold by slowing growth and MVOC production. If odors remain intense despite effective dehumidification, extensive hidden mold likely exists, requiring professional removal.
However, dehumidification alone cannot eliminate existing mold. While controlling future growth, musty smell persists from established colonies, requiring physical removal through professional mold remediation services.

The 24-48 hour mold growth window:
Mold begins growing on wet materials within 24-48 hours after water exposure. By 72 hours, colonies establish sufficiently to produce a detectable musty smell. This rapid timeline makes immediate action critical after any Burlington basement water damage.
If musty smell appears within days of water damage from burst pipes, foundation leaks, or flooding, mold growth has definitively begun, requiring professional intervention to prevent extensive contamination.
Types of water damage creating mold:
Clean water from the supply line leaks provides 48-72 hours before mold establishment. Gray water from appliances accelerates growth starting within 24-48 hours. Black water from sewage or flooding creates immediate contamination, with mold and bacteria growth beginning within hours.
Any category of water damage left unaddressed creates musty smell within days. According to the Centers for Disease Control, prompt drying represents the most effective mold prevention method after water damage.
Hidden moisture creates hidden mold:
Water damage often affects hidden areas, including wall cavities, under flooring, and in insulation. These locations stay wet for extended periods even when visible surfaces appear dry. Hidden moisture creates hidden mold, producing a musty smell without visible growth.
Professional moisture detection using thermal imaging and moisture meters locates hidden water damage, guiding thorough drying and preventing mold establishment and associated musty smells.

Common mold exposure symptoms:
Respiratory effects represent the most common mold exposure symptoms. These include nasal congestion, throat irritation, coughing, wheezing, and difficulty breathing. Individuals with asthma experience increased attack frequency and severity.
Allergic reactions manifest as sneezing, a runny nose, red eyes, and skin rashes. Some individuals develop new allergies to mold after prolonged exposure, creating lifetime sensitization.
Neurological and systemic effects:
While less common, some individuals experience headaches, fatigue, difficulty concentrating, and memory problems from mold exposure. These symptoms are particularly associated with toxic mold species, though any extensive mold growth can create these effects in sensitive individuals.
Children, the elderly, pregnant women, and immunocompromised individuals face the greatest health risks from a musty smell indicating mold exposure. Any symptoms in vulnerable populations warrant immediate professional assessment.
The “feel better when away” pattern:
A clear indicator of home environmental mold problems: symptoms improve significantly when away from home for extended periods and then return or worsen upon coming home. This pattern strongly suggests musty smell results from actual mold contamination rather than other causes.

Types of moisture indicators:
Active dampness on walls, floors, or ceilings obviously supports mold growth. However, historical water stains showing past moisture exposure also indicate likely mold presence. Water infiltration creates mold that persists even after surfaces dry.
Efflorescence (white mineral deposits) on concrete indicates moisture wicking through the foundation. This moisture supports mold growth on organic materials like drywall, wood, or stored items, creating musty smell even when the concrete itself appears relatively dry.

Mapping odor patterns:
Walking through Burlington basements, noting where musty smell appears strongest, provides investigative clues. Concentrated odors near exterior walls suggest foundation moisture or drainage problems. Strong smells near plumbing indicate potential pipe leaks. Intense odors in corners reveal ventilation deficiencies.
This odor mapping guides professional inspection toward likely contamination sources, enabling efficient investigation and targeted remediation.
High-risk basement locations:
Certain basement areas experience higher mold risk, creating a concentrated musty smell. Floor-wall joints where basement floors meet walls. Rim joists along the basement perimeters. Areas near sump pump basins. Locations under first-floor bathrooms or kitchens. Window wells and basement window areas.
When musty smell concentrates in these high-risk locations, professional inspection should prioritize these areas while investigating the entire basement comprehensively.
Smell intensity and contamination extent:
A strong, intense, musty smell indicates heavy mold growth. Mild diffuse odors suggest light contamination. Smell intensity generally correlates with mold extent, though exceptions exist when small toxic mold colonies produce strong odors.

Mold versus mildew odors:
Mildew represents surface mold growing on materials in high humidity. Mildew produces a similar musty smell to deeper mold but appears as surface growth easily cleaned. True mold penetrates materials requiring removal rather than surface cleaning.
Both create musty smell. However, mildew responds to cleaning and humidity control, while mold requires professional remediation. If musty smell persists despite cleaning the surface of mildew, deeper mold exists, requiring expert assessment.
Other basement odor sources:
Sewage or sewer gas produces distinct foul odors different from earthy, moldy, or musty smells. Chemical odors from paints, solvents, or stored materials differ from biological mold smells. Pet odors have characteristic ammonia qualities.
Dead rodents or other decomposition create intensely foul odors, unlike the musty smell from mold. Standing water produces dank odors without the earthy biological quality of mold smells.

Can musty smell exist without visible mold?
Yes, musty smell frequently occurs without visible mold because most Burlington basement mold grows in hidden locations, including inside walls, under flooring, in insulation, or ceiling plenums, where contamination remains invisible while producing detectable odors. Mold also releases volatile organic compounds, creating musty smell at very low concentrations before growth becomes extensive enough for visual detection. Does a dehumidifier eliminate musty smell from mold?
Dehumidifiers reduce humidity, preventing new mold growth, and may slightly decrease musty smell intensity by slowing existing mold activity. However, dehumidifiers cannot eliminate musty smells from established mold colonies, requiring physical removal. Dehumidification provides important moisture control, preventing recurrence after professional mold remediation, but it cannot substitute for proper contamination removal. Will painting over mold eliminate musty smell?
No, painting over mold never eliminates musty smell because paint seals surface mold but cannot stop living colonies from continuing growth, releasing spores, and producing volatile organic compounds, creating odors. Paint also provides an additional food source supporting mold growth. Many Burlington homeowners discover a musty smell worsening after painting over mold problems. Proper mold remediation requires complete removal of contaminated materials, decontamination of remaining surfaces, and moisture elimination.
